Researching Local Tree Trimming Companies in Immokalee
When it comes to maintaining your property's aesthetic appeal and safety, hiring a reliable tree trimming company is crucial. In Immokalee, Florida, the subtropical climate means that trees can grow rapidly, but also require regular maintenance to prevent damage from storms, pests, and diseases.
As you search for a reputable tree trimming company in Immokalee, consider factors like their experience with local species, equipment, and certifications. Check online reviews from sites like Yelp or Google to see how previous customers have rated their services.
Factors to Consider When Hiring a Tree Trimming Company
* Licensing and Certifications: Ensure the company is licensed by the Florida Department of Agriculture and Consumer Services (FDACS) and certified arborists on staff. * Equipment: Look for companies with modern, well-maintained equipment, such as chippers and aerial lifts. * Insurance: Verify that they have liability insurance to protect your property in case of accidents.
Understanding Tree Trimming Prices in Immokalee
The cost of tree trimming services can vary depending on factors like the type and size of trees, location, and level of difficulty. In Immokalee, you can expect to pay between $200 to $1,500 or more per job.
Estimated Costs for Common Tree Trimming Services in Immokalee
* Small Trees (less than 30 feet tall): $150-$300 * Medium Trees (30-60 feet tall): $250-$600 * Large Trees (over 60 feet tall): $500-$1,200 or more
Seasonal Tree Trimming Tips for Immokalee Homeowners
In the subtropical climate of Immokalee, trees require regular maintenance throughout the year. Consider the following tips:
Spring (March to May)
* Remove dead branches: After winter storms, inspect your trees and remove any damaged or dead branches. * Fertilize: Apply a balanced fertilizer to promote healthy growth.
Summer (June to September)
* Monitor for pests: Keep an eye out for pests like aphids, whiteflies, and scales, which thrive in the warm weather. * Water deeply: Water your trees regularly, especially during periods of drought.
Fall (October to November)
* Prune trees: Prune trees to maintain shape and promote healthy growth. * Mulch around trees: Apply a 2-3 inch layer of organic mulch around tree bases to retain moisture and suppress weeds.
